Insurance Agent Elected to Arkansas Lieutenant Governor Post
Republican Mark Darr, an insurance agent, will be Arkansas’ next lieutenant governor, having beaten Democrat Shane Broadway on Nov. 2. Darr, from Rogers, clinched the victory in a close race in his first attempt at elected office. He is an agent for Wealthbridge Financial Services and also owns the Mad Pizza Co. Broadway is a state senator from Bryant and a former speaker of the Arkansas House.
The lieutenant governor’s office is a part-time job and largely ceremonial in nature.
